Regular oil changes represent one of the extremely important maintenance tasks for maintaining your truck working efficiently . In spite of their significance , many drivers overlook or postpone oil changes, resulting in costly repairs and decreased vehicle performance. In this write-up , we'll delve into why oil changes are essential and how they enhance your vehicle.

Lubrication: Oil lubricates the engine's operational parts, minimizing friction and avoiding wear and tear. Over time, oil deteriorates and becomes less effective, boosting the threat of engine damage. Routine oil changes confirm that your engine keeps properly lubricated, prolonging its lifespan and maintaining optimal performance.

Cooling: Oil aids to cool the engine by taking heat away from the combustion chamber. With aging oil , it loses its ability to disperse heat, leading to overheating. Regular oil changes help fend off overheating and guarantee that your engine runs at the correct temperature.

Cleaning: Oil contributes to cleaning the engine by transporting away muck, debris, and contaminants. As oil ages , it turns less effective at cleaning, leading to the buildup of debris and deposits. Routine oil changes assist to ensure your engine spotless and avoid damage from contaminants.

Improved Fuel Efficiency: Clean oil decreases friction within the engine, that Get started can improve fuel efficiency. By regularly changing your oil, you can aid to maintain top fuel economy and cut your overall fuel costs.

Prevents Engine Wear: Over time, oil can become contaminated with grime , metal particles, and other debris. This contaminated oil can lead to increased engine wear and damage. Regular oil changes aid to get rid of contaminated oil and swap it with clean oil, reducing the risk of engine damage.

Extends Engine Life: By making sure that your engine is properly lubricated, cooled, and cleaned, regular oil changes can contribute to extend the life of your engine. Proper maintenance can dodge costly repairs and maintain your vehicle running smoothly for years to come.

In conclusion, frequent oil changes are crucial for maintaining the health and performance of your truck. By following the manufacturer's recommendations for oil changes, you can make sure that your engine continues to be properly lubricated, cooled, and pristine , resulting in improved performance, fuel efficiency, and overall longevity of your vehicle.
